Cover M of each Youngblood issue will present the artwork in black, white, and gray tones, and the main pop of color will be through splashes of red, but it gets better. That’s because this same art style and approach will be featured on the covers and the interior pages, and as you can see below, it looks fantastic.

โI love the style and design of Manga comics and I created an approach to my work that attempts to mimic those artistic influences with the Youngblood manga editions,” Liefeld said. “These have proved extremely popular with consumers! Iโll be doing a manga edition alongside each issue!”
Youngblood #1 Brings Back the Series’ Missing Ingredient


Earlier this year, Image Comics released the Youngblood Deluxe single issues, which promptly sold out pretty much instantly. Now the team is back with their own ongoing series, and things pick up after the team is summoned to a crisis in the Pacific. Suddenly, a mysterious vessel appears, but the real surprise is the return of a deadly foe soon after, and the team is going to have to adapt quickly if they hope to take them down.
